From 551ab9e1372755256d91b23f1af2b5fabdb551f7 Mon Sep 17 00:00:00 2001 From: Milan Nikolic Date: Thu, 14 Sep 2023 15:02:27 +0200 Subject: [PATCH] Change flatpak exec/command name to cbconvert --- .../flatpak/io.github.gen2brain.cbconvert.desktop | 2 +- .../io.github.gen2brain.cbconvert.metainfo.xml | 8 ++++++++ .../linux/flatpak/io.github.gen2brain.cbconvert.yml | 12 ++++++------ 3 files changed, 15 insertions(+), 7 deletions(-) diff --git a/cmd/cbconvert-gui/dist/linux/flatpak/io.github.gen2brain.cbconvert.desktop b/cmd/cbconvert-gui/dist/linux/flatpak/io.github.gen2brain.cbconvert.desktop index 75f9c4e..1153d5f 100644 --- a/cmd/cbconvert-gui/dist/linux/flatpak/io.github.gen2brain.cbconvert.desktop +++ b/cmd/cbconvert-gui/dist/linux/flatpak/io.github.gen2brain.cbconvert.desktop @@ -2,7 +2,7 @@ Name=CBconvert GenericName=A Comic Book converter Comment=A comic converter with support for .cb*, .pdf, .xps, .epub, .mobi and directories -Exec=cbconvert-gui +Exec=cbconvert Icon=io.github.gen2brain.cbconvert Terminal=false Type=Application diff --git a/cmd/cbconvert-gui/dist/linux/flatpak/io.github.gen2brain.cbconvert.metainfo.xml b/cmd/cbconvert-gui/dist/linux/flatpak/io.github.gen2brain.cbconvert.metainfo.xml index 3a288d4..649671b 100644 --- a/cmd/cbconvert-gui/dist/linux/flatpak/io.github.gen2brain.cbconvert.metainfo.xml +++ b/cmd/cbconvert-gui/dist/linux/flatpak/io.github.gen2brain.cbconvert.metainfo.xml @@ -30,6 +30,14 @@ https://github.com/gen2brain/cbconvert/issues + + +
    +
  • Change flatpak exec/command name to cbconvert
  • +
+
+ https://github.com/gen2brain/cbconvert/releases/tag/v1.0.2 +
    diff --git a/cmd/cbconvert-gui/dist/linux/flatpak/io.github.gen2brain.cbconvert.yml b/cmd/cbconvert-gui/dist/linux/flatpak/io.github.gen2brain.cbconvert.yml index 3533a44..df93279 100644 --- a/cmd/cbconvert-gui/dist/linux/flatpak/io.github.gen2brain.cbconvert.yml +++ b/cmd/cbconvert-gui/dist/linux/flatpak/io.github.gen2brain.cbconvert.yml @@ -5,7 +5,7 @@ sdk: org.freedesktop.Sdk sdk-extensions: - org.freedesktop.Sdk.Extension.golang -command: cbconvert-gui +command: cbconvert finish-args: - --share=ipc @@ -47,7 +47,7 @@ modules: sha256: 7a4c6077f45180926583e2087571371bdd9cb21b6e6fada85a6fbd544f26a0e2 - name: highway - buildsystem: cmake + buildsystem: cmake-ninja config-opts: - -DBUILD_SHARED_LIBS=ON - -DHWY_ENABLE_TESTS=OFF @@ -59,7 +59,7 @@ modules: sha256: 5434488108186c170a5e2fca5e3c9b6ef59a1caa4d520b008a9b8be6b8abe6c5 - name: libjxl - buildsystem: cmake + buildsystem: cmake-ninja config-opts: - -DBUILD_SHARED_LIBS=ON - -DJPEGXL_ENABLE_BENCHMARK=OFF @@ -154,14 +154,14 @@ modules: buildsystem: simple build-commands: - cp cmd/cbconvert-gui/dist/linux/flatpak/modules.txt cmd/cbconvert-gui/vendor/ - - cd cmd/cbconvert-gui && $GOROOT/bin/go build -mod=vendor -trimpath -tags "extlib portal" -ldflags "-s -w -X main.appVersion=1.0.1" - - install -Dm00755 cmd/cbconvert-gui/cbconvert-gui $FLATPAK_DEST/bin/cbconvert-gui + - cd cmd/cbconvert-gui && $GOROOT/bin/go build -mod=vendor -trimpath -tags "extlib portal" -ldflags "-s -w -X main.appVersion=1.0.2" + - install -Dm00755 cmd/cbconvert-gui/cbconvert-gui $FLATPAK_DEST/bin/cbconvert - install -Dm00644 cmd/cbconvert-gui/dist/linux/cbconvert.png $FLATPAK_DEST/share/icons/hicolor/256x256/apps/$FLATPAK_ID.png - install -Dm00644 cmd/cbconvert-gui/dist/linux/flatpak/$FLATPAK_ID.desktop $FLATPAK_DEST/share/applications/$FLATPAK_ID.desktop - install -Dm00644 cmd/cbconvert-gui/dist/linux/flatpak/$FLATPAK_ID.metainfo.xml $FLATPAK_DEST/share/metainfo/$FLATPAK_ID.metainfo.xml sources: - type: archive - url: https://github.com/gen2brain/cbconvert/archive/refs/tags/v1.0.1.tar.gz + url: https://github.com/gen2brain/cbconvert/archive/refs/tags/v1.0.2.tar.gz sha256: 34964e24fb8a81e6a2b7e556de8aa28d5b5fbd5698157f67fb5e7e9ee02330cc - type: archive